常用名 甲拌磷 英文名 Phorate
CAS号 298-02-2 分子量 260.377
密度 1.2±0.1 g/cm3 沸点 296.0±42.0 °C at 760 mmHg
分子式 C7H17O2PS3 熔点 -43°C
MSDS 中文版 美版 闪点 132.8±27.9 °C
符号 GHS06 GHS09
GHS06, GHS09
信号词 Danger
